Gradle簡介和安裝

一.Gradle介紹linux

   Gradle是一個基於JVM的構建工具,它提供了:像Ant同樣,通用靈活的構建工具,能夠切換的,基於約定的構建框架,強大的多工程構建支持,基於Apache Ivy的強大的依賴管理,支持maven, Ivy倉庫,支持傳遞性依賴管理,而不須要遠程倉庫或者是pom.xml和ivy.xml配置文件。對Ant的任務作了很好的集成,基於Groovy,build腳本使用Groovy編寫,有普遍的領域模型支持構建編程

二.Gradle 概述windows

   基於聲明和基於約定的構建。依賴型的編程語言。能夠結構化構建,易於維護和理解。有高級的API容許你在構建執行的整個過程中,對它的核心進行監視,或者是配置它的行爲。有良好的擴展性。有增量構建功能來克服性能瓶頸問題。多項目構建的支持。多種方式的依賴管理。是第一個構建集成工具。集成了Ant, maven的功能。易於移值,腳本採用Groovy編寫,易於維護。經過Gradle Wrapper容許你在沒有安裝Gradle的機器上進行Gradle構建。自由,開源。app

三.Gradle 安裝框架

  1,安裝JDK,並配置JAVA_HOME環境變量。由於Gradle是用Groovy編寫的,而Groovy基於JAVA。另外,Java版本要不小於1.5.maven

  2,下載。地址是:http://www.gradle.org/downloads 做爲初學者建議選擇包含文檔和樣例源碼的壓縮文件較好,將下載文件解壓。若是你下載的是gradle-xx-all.zip的完整包,它會有如下內容:二進制文件用戶手冊(包括PDF和HTML兩種版本),DSL參考指南,API手冊(包括Javadoc和Groovydoc),樣例源代碼,僅供參考使用。編程語言

  4,配置環境變量。工具

   4.1 在windows中的Gradle配置:在環境變量對話框中,定義環境變量GRADLE_HOME,設置路徑。以下圖所示。性能

    

   而後把%GRADLE_HOME%/bin(linux或mac的是$GRADLE_HOME/bin)加到PATH的環境變量。配置完成以後,運行gradle -v,檢查一下是否安裝無誤。若是安裝正確,它會打印出Gradle的版本信息,包括它的構建信息,Groovy, Ant, Ivy, 當前JVM和當前系統的版本信息。gradle

 

 5.設置Gradle的VM選項配置信息

另外,能夠經過GRADLE_OPTS或JAVA_OPTS來配置Gradle運行時的JVM參數。不過,JAVA_OPTS設置的參數也會影響到其餘的JAVA應用程序。若是你想要傳遞特定參數給Gradle運行時,則使用環境變量GRADLE_OPTS。假設你想要增長默認的最大堆內存爲1GB,則能夠這樣設置,GRADLE_OPTS="-Xmx1024m",可是最好的方式是將變量添加到$GRADLE_HOME/bin目錄下的Gradle的啓動腳本中。

轉載請註明:http://www.xujin.org

相關文章
相關標籤/搜索